About this ebook
This book was designed to help parents of children diagnosed with Obsessive Compulsive Disorder. As someone who has struggled with this illness, I know firsthand what it's like to grow up feeling like something is wrong with you and not know what it is. Hopefully by reading my book you can gain the courage and knowledge that you need to team up with your child to fight their OCD and WIN!
Cynthia Cossu
My name is Cynthia and I have suffered from Obsessive Compulsive Disorder from a very early age. It is a challenge every day; one that I would not wish upon anyone! My hope is to raise awareness of OCD and help children get help earlier on in their lives. We CAN beat OCD and win! :)

You just stepped out of the Psychiatrist office, and your mind is spinning with thoughts. How could this have happened? Where did my child get this? I don't understand. We did everything right. Well he couldn't have gotten it from my side of the family!! All of these thoughts and more may be crossing your mind right now. You're not sure of what the future holds for your child, and you feel scared and alone. Have no fear! You are NOT alone! I'm going to tell you what to expect, what to you should DO and what you should definitely NOT to do.
